I have been using this specific microphone for 2 years. Its construction quality is excellent. You feel that it is a serious microphone that doesn't joke around. It is heavy enough. I have used it with the stand that comes in the package, which is a desk stand, and I have also bought a separate regular stand. I use it for radio broadcasts, livestreams, videos, and singing. It has the clarity and performance of a professional microphone. It connects with XLR because it is a condenser microphone. This means that the console or mixer it will be placed on must have phantom power functionality. Alternatively, you can purchase an additional accessory for 10 euros, where you can connect the microphone to the input of the Phantom power accessory, and a cable will come out for the console or mixer you always want to connect it with XLR.
